Increasing numbers of families are making music festivals their annual vacation. Although most music festivals are incredibly large with a focus upon making cash, there are a small selection of family music festivals, for example Tartan Heart and the Wickerman Festival.
The Wickerman Festival is an annual music and arts festival takes place on a farm close to Dundrennan, Dumfries & Galloway about 5 miles from Kirkcudbright in Scotland. The event theme is the cult British movie “The Wicker Man which features appearances by Christopher Lee, Edward Woodward, Diane Cilento, Ingrid Pitt and Britt Ekland.
The very first festival took place in July, 2002 and was put together by a local man called Sid Ambrose. With little experience of organizing an event of such magnitude it is amazing that it still exists, especially when you consider the current economic climate. Wickerman has slightly changed each year and, like the movie, has a cult following.
The festival is incredibly family friendly it has numerous activities for children including, a fairground, a mountain biking trail, face painting and workshops. This can be easily proven by make a simple search for Wickerman Festival photos 2009 or alternatively visit the official Wickerman Festival Gallery.
Not too far from the festival site is Kirkudbright where you will discover many locations used in the film including Harbour Cottage (the bakery) and High Street Gallery (May Morrison’s post office and sweetshop).
